We are a whippet family and we lost our previous whippet to a tragic freak accident in January. Her sister, Shasta, was incredibly depressed and kept searching for her sister. We found her a new sister in Yona.

September 15 Yona went in for a spay and a few days later she spiked with a fever and lethargy. After numerous tests and ultrasounds it was found that she had a uterine stump infection and she went in for her second surgery on the 25th. After that surgery she continued to wax and wane with a high temperature and decreased appetite to the point of losing weight. Our wonderful Drs. at Klaich Animal Hospital have done everything in their capacity to try to find what was wrong with her. It was a joint decision between our team of Drs, Thawny, and myself to have Yona cared for at UC Davis. We made the journey down to UC Davis on Tuesday October 6. Yona has an amazing team at UC Davis that have fallen in love with her but are still stumped as to what is going on with her. They have found that she has jejunal ulcers and still has no appetite and has lost 7lbs in less than a month but no primary diagnosis. 

We are continuing with tests and diagnostics to find the primary cause but need help at this time. This is our child and we are imploring on some assistance to help make her better.
